Inter continental Hotels Confirms Breach at 12 HotelsAn announcement made by InterContinental Hotel Group (IHG) confirmed that a credit card breach affected at least 12 of its properties in the United States. IHG released a statement explaining it found malicious software installed on point of sale servers between August and December 2016 at restaurants and bars of 12 IHG-managed properties. The stolen credit card data included information stored on the magnetic stripe of credit and debit cards, including card holder name, card number, expiration data, and internal verification code |

Cloud Security & Compliance in ActionThe cloud has created a level of convenience and scalability that was unprecedented until just a few years ago. However, while cloud adoption has gained popularity over the last few years, security and compliance have historically been lacking in this field. The daunting task of incorporating a cloud environment into any business is a headache enough, not to mention the complexities a business has to face when complying with regulatory standards. But these standards are put in place to ensure sensitive data stored in the cloud has safeguards implemented to protect clients, employees, and companies from online harm. |

NEW YORK STATE REVEALS NEW CYBERSECURITY REGULATIONS FOR FINANCIAL INDUSTRYThe governor of New York State, Andrew Cuomo, announced last Thursday comprehensive new cyber security regulations for the financial service industry, in an effort to improve cyber resilience within the financial sector and keep customer data safe. |
